Geometric 204e24 is an abstraction of a kaleidoscopic image. There are several versions of the main image (Geometric 204), each distinct in coloration and color palette. This version, 204e24 is offered as as both a limited edition of 5 prints, signed, numbered and dated on the reverse, and as an open (unsigned edition).

Because this version exists as both a limited edition (see additional entry for this image) and as an open edition (this image), the limited edition pricing is significantly less than a limited edition work of the same size for which no open edition prints are offered.

Ken Lerner is a ionate photographic artist, born into a family of renowned photographers. He began taking photos at the age of 6, using a camera given to him by his father. But he was not interested in simply reproducing real life moments. His vision was more subjective and he sought to project an internal reality of that moment.

At the beginning of his career, he almost exclusively created images with multiple exposures. This gave a complex structure to the images and represented a subjective view of the world. In the 2010s, after working in financial product sales, he returned to photography producing only single exposure images. Even though they were less structurally complex, they still represented a subjective view of the world, being almost totally abstract. Ken works extensively with reflective surfaces such as water, glass and metal.

A lover of the beauty of nature, Ken Lerner paints and photographs a lot of landscapes and seascapes. He is interested in presenting different possibilities of representing "nature" and often produces many variations of an image with different colors, shades, contrasts and saturations.
